Troubleshooting Questions and Answers:

1. Question: Why is the sound not working after updating the sound driver on Windows 8?
Answer: This issue might occur if the sound driver update was not installed properly. You can try uninstalling the driver and reinstalling it to resolve the problem. Alternatively, check if the audio settings are correctly configured and the volume is not muted.

2. Question: How can I identify if the sound driver update on Windows 8 is causing performance issues or conflicts?
Answer: If you experience performance issues or conflicts after updating the sound driver on Windows 8, it could be due to compatibility issues or software conflicts. To determine if the update is the cause, you can try rolling back to the previous driver version or uninstalling the update. If the issues are resolved, it indicates that the driver update was causing the problem.

3. Question: Is it possible to revert back to the original sound driver version on Windows 8?
Answer: Yes, it is possible to revert back to the original sound driver version on Windows 8. You can do this by opening the Device Manager, locating the sound driver under the "Sound, video, and game controllers" section, right-clicking on it, and selecting the "Roll Back Driver" option. This will restore the previously installed sound driver version. However, note that this option may not be available if no previous driver version is available or if the rollback option is disabled.
